Data from the Along Track Scanning Radiometer 2 (ATSR-2) on board the European ERS-2 satellite have been used to derive the spatial distribution of the aerosol optical depth (AOD) over Europe for August 1997. The AOD was retrieved in cloud-free areas using the dual view algorithm. The results agree with co-located ground based sun-photometer data within 0.1. The AOD from ATSR-2 with a resolution of 1 x 1 km(2) were averaged on a grid of 0.1 degrees x 0.1 degrees, to produce daily maps of the spatial aerosol distribution over Europe. A composite map of AOD over Europe was constructed by averaging all daily maps for August 1997. This composite map shows large spatial AOD gradients with variations of a factor of 3 over a few hundreds of kilometers. The AOD at 0.555 mu m for relatively clean areas is around 0.1 while in strong industrialised areas the AOD can be 0.5 or higher.
